From a1b33bdfeb09a53262e65a6318486aedb1170eb4 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: ratorik Date: Fri, 17 Jan 2025 15:16:03 +0100 Subject: [PATCH 1/2] fix: resolve issue when updating or adding content type with draft enabled fix: resolve Meilisearch issue with draftAndPublish enabled When updating or adding an item with draftAndPublish enabled, the item is removed from Meilisearch, and the following error occurs: error: Meilisearch could not add entry with id: 9: Transaction query already complete This issue is described in https://github.com/meilisearch/strapi-plugin-meilisearch/issues/997. The item should update correctly without errors when draftAndPublish is enabled. --- server/src/services/lifecycle/lifecycle.js | 24 ++++------------------ 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 20
